#5d57e8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5d57e8 is composed of 36.5% red, 34.1% green and 91%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.9% cyan, 62.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 242.5 degrees, a saturation of 75.9% and a lightness of 62.5%. #5d57e8 color hex could be obtained by blending #baaeff with #0000d1.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

Shades and Tints of #5d57e8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010105 is the darkest color, while #f3f2f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#5d57e8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9a99a6 is the less saturated color, while #4941fe is the most saturated one.
